Related Material:For records of Chorlton and Manchester Joint Asylum Committee: Ledgers 1897-1913 see M4/90/1-19.
For a history of the colony see Jean Barclay, Langho Colony / Langho Centre. 1906-1984: A Contextual Study of Manchester's Public Institution for people with Epilepsy which is held in the Local Studies Library (ref: Q 362.196853Ba(850)).

Custodial history:
The Langho Colony was founded by the Joint Asylum Committee of the Chorlton and Manchester Board of Guardians in the Ribble Valley in 1906 as a hospital for epileptics. In 1929 its control passed to Manchester City Council. It closed in 1984.
